Bob Saget
THE 21ST QUESTION:
Let's settle another urban myth once and for all. Alanis Morissette's bitter breakup anthem, "You Oughta Know," was allegedly about a certain actor on Full House, either you or Dave Coulier. Can you finally come out and admit that you're Mr. Duplicity?
SAGET:
I'm sorry to say that's not in any way true. I did sleep with a few members of 'N Sync, but that's something I'd prefer to keep private. I met Alanis a few times and she's a very, very lovely girl, but I've never dated her. To my knowledge, the song was a composite of a couple of people that disappointed her, not just one person. Now, if you're asking whether I ever had inappropriate sexual relations with Dave Coulier, our relationship was strictly professional. John Stamos and I have held hands. In fact -- and this is entirely true -- we held hands and I believe my head was on his shoulder during an Elvis impersonator's act in Vegas. We were up all night and he fed me because I'd had too much to drink. And then we spooned in his hotel room and he woke up in the morning and said to me, "Oh, my god, it feels like a piece of shit took a shit in my mouth." I probably shouldn't have told you that story because I just got in trouble for telling another story about him and his mom got upset. I need to learn how to shut the fuck up.
